From: Gabor Greif Date: Wed, 21 May 2008 14:07:30 +0000 (+0000) Subject: suppress gcc3.4.6's warnings X-Git-Url: http://plrg.eecs.uci.edu/git/?a=commitdiff_plain;h=33e456d5f3909e0c7b96e04e5674c25a182da100;p=oota-llvm.git suppress gcc3.4.6's warnings git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@51372 91177308-0d34-0410-b5e6-96231b3b80d8 --- diff --git a/lib/Analysis/ConstantFolding.cpp b/lib/Analysis/ConstantFolding.cpp index 91c745e9326..7601aeb2f4f 100644 --- a/lib/Analysis/ConstantFolding.cpp +++ b/lib/Analysis/ConstantFolding.cpp @@ -602,6 +602,7 @@ static Constant *ConstantFoldFP(double (*NativeFP)(double), double V, if (Ty == Type::DoubleTy) return ConstantFP::get(APFloat(V)); assert(0 && "Can only constant fold float/double"); + return 0; // dummy return to suppress warning } static Constant *ConstantFoldBinaryFP(double (*NativeFP)(double, double), @@ -619,6 +620,7 @@ static Constant *ConstantFoldBinaryFP(double (*NativeFP)(double, double), if (Ty == Type::DoubleTy) return ConstantFP::get(APFloat(V)); assert(0 && "Can only constant fold float/double"); + return 0; // dummy return to suppress warning } /// ConstantFoldCall - Attempt to constant fold a call to the specified function